Anyway, I wanted to say that me and 4 other Stanford students and recent grads just launched our time lapse product, called Radian on kickstarter - a motion time-lapse device that is priced at $125.

Our fundamental goal was to make time-lapsing extremely affordable and accessible to people of all backgrounds while still being fully featured and capable of meeting a professional's needs. We spent months working on this, both in the lab and in the field with both beginners and professionals alike (like the people who made Yosemite HD) to bring our product to where it is today.

The five of us are doing this for zero profit, because we personally just want to get this product in the hands of people everywhere for the sake of empowering individuals to create beautiful vignettes of the world around us.
